Photo: Driver airlifted from crash site

Lawrence-Douglas County Fire & Medical personnel tend to the victim of an accident as Douglas County Sheriff's officers inspect an overturned car in the 1900 section of North 1200 Road, about 2 1/2 miles southwest of Eudora. The driver lost control of her car Tuesday afternoon, and the car landed in a dry creek bed. Rescue workers had to cut open the roof of the car to extricate the victim, a sheriff's spokesman said. The woman, who was not identified, was taken by LifeNet helicopter to the University of Kansas Hospital in Kansas City, Kan. The cause of the accident is still under investigation. The Eudora Township Fire Department, Eudora emergency medical technicians and the Kansas Highway Patrol also responded to the wreck.
